Cellpoint Digital scales payment orchestration data platform with BigQuery, Pub/Sub, and GKE

CellPoint Digital is rebuilding its payment orchestration infrastructure on Google Cloud to improve scalability and become more data-driven. The company supports travel payments across multiple currencies, banks, and payment methods, and uses the new platform to streamline data access, reporting, and decision-making. A three-tier microservices architecture on Google Kubernetes Engine ingests operational events through Pub/Sub into analytical services, with raw data written to BigQuery and then transformed with Dataflow and SQL/dbt for reporting and analytics.

Architecture

A three-tier microservices platform runs on Google Kubernetes Engine. Operational data is streamed via Pub/Sub into analytical services. Raw data is written to BigQuery and backed up to object storage, then transformed using Dataflow and SQL/dbt into structures for dashboards and reporting. Looker serves downstream self-service analytics, while GCP platform services such as Cloud Build and Cloud Run support engineering workflows.
